What Is ESWT and How Does It Work?
Extracorporeal Shock Wave Therapy (ESWT) is a non-invasive therapeutic technology that uses high-energy acoustic waves to stimulate biological healing mechanisms within the body. These sound waves promote cellular regeneration, reduce inflammation, and improve blood flow, offering exceptional benefits for conditions like tendonitis, plantar fasciitis, calcific shoulder pain, and other musculoskeletal disorders.
In simple terms, ESWT accelerates recovery by sending pulses into injured tissue, increasing metabolic activity and initiating a controlled healing response. The Key Benefits of ESWT
ESWT offers a wide range of therapeutic advantages, especially for chronic soft-tissue pain and sports injuries. Its non-invasive nature makes it ideal for patients seeking fast, safe, and drug-free recovery.
Main Benefits of ESWT
- Non-invasive pain relief without medication or surgery.
- Stimulation of tissue regeneration by activating cell repair mechanisms.
- Improved blood circulation and metabolic activity in injured tissue.
- Accelerated healing for chronic musculoskeletal disorders.
- Breakdown of calcifications in the shoulder, heel, and tendons.
- Enhanced mobility and functional performance.
- Fast treatment sessions with no downtime.
Table 1: Biological Effects of ESWT
| Biological Response | Clinical Impact |
|---|---|
| Increased collagen production | Stronger, healthier tendon and ligament repair |
| Improved blood vessel formation | Better circulation and accelerated healing |
| Reduction of inflammatory mediators | Less pain and swelling |
| Mechanical breakdown of scar tissue | Restored mobility and function |
Conditions Effectively Treated by ESWT
Shockwave therapy is widely recognized for its effectiveness in treating chronic and acute musculoskeletal conditions. It is especially beneficial for athletes, active individuals, and patients who have not responded to traditional therapy.
Common Conditions Treated
- Plantar fasciitis
- Tennis elbow (lateral epicondylitis)
- Achilles tendonitis
- Shoulder calcific tendonitis
- Patellar tendonitis (jumper’s knee)
- Hip bursitis
- Trigger point pain
- Chronic muscular tension
Table 2: ESWT Success Rates by Condition
| Condition | Reported Success Rate |
|---|---|
| Plantar Fasciitis | 80–90% |
| Tennis Elbow | 70–85% |
| Achilles Tendinopathy | 65–80% |
| Calcific Shoulder Tendonitis | 75–90% |
ESWT vs. Traditional Pain Treatments
Compared to common treatment options, ESWT stands out for its safety, non-invasive nature, and ability to target the root cause of pain instead of masking symptoms.
Table 3: Comparison of Treatment Options
| Treatment Type | Invasiveness | Risks | Effectiveness |
|---|---|---|---|
| ESWT | Non-invasive | Minimal temporary soreness | High success for chronic pain |
| Corticosteroid Injection | Minimally invasive | Tissue weakening, recurrence | Short-term relief |
| Surgery | Invasive | Long recovery, infection risk | Only when conservative care fails |
What to Expect During ESWT Treatment
ESWT sessions are fast, safe, and comfortable for most patients. Here is a general treatment overview:
- Session duration: 5–15 minutes
- Typical frequency: 3–6 sessions spaced one week apart
- Pain level: Mild discomfort that decreases as tissue heals
- Downtime: None — patients resume activities immediately
